core-outline
Version:
A React component for Core&Outline
51 lines (37 loc) • 882 B
Markdown
# CoreOutline React Component
A React component for integrating Core&Outline session recording and event tracking into your web application.
## Installation
Install the package using npm:
```sh
npm install core-outline
```
or using yarn:
```sh
yarn add core-outline
```
```sh
import React from 'react';
import CoreOutline from 'core-outline';
function App() {
return (
<CoreOutline
data_source_id={{ YOUR_DATA_SOURCE_ID }}
data_source_secret={{ YOUR_DATA_SOURCE_SECRET }}>
{/* Your app components */}
</CoreOutline>
);
}
export default App;
```
To flag items clicked or purchased:
```sh
import { flag_item_clicked, flag_item_purchased } from 'core-outline;
```
To flag items clicked:
```sh
flag_item_clicked('ITEM_ID');
```
To flag items purchased:
```sh
flag_item_purchased('ITEM_ID');
```